Safety

These inspections not only will ensure that your AC is in good enough condition for the summer months, but are also a huge priority when it comes to keeping you and your family safe.

Inside an Ac unit Carbon monoxide poisoning, fires, and electrical problems are a few things that can happen if your HVAC unit is not maintained properly. Gas leaks and wiring issues are among the many things that an HVAC professional will look for during one of these inspections.

 

 

Regularly scheduling routine checks will help to prevent some of these terrible accidents from taking place in your home and help to protect you and your family.

Save on Your Energy Bills and Repairs

If your air conditioner has any existing issues, it can cause the unit to have to work harder to cool your home down resulting in a hefty energy bill. When you schedule regular maintenance inspections, a professional will be able to pinpoint the problem so this can be avoided.

Air conditioning savings A properly functioning AC unit will be more efficient than one that is having any issues. To keep your air conditioner summer ready, it will need to be maintained so that it does not work too hard to keep your air cool. A clogged or dirty air filter may cause your AC to work harder and not as efficiently. When your air conditioner has to work harder it uses more energy resulting in a large bill.

Increased work of your AC unit can also cause stress to the hardware which can cause broken parts. During your periodic inspections, these issues can be identified and replaced or repaired ahead of time. Emergency repairs are always far more expensive than those that would be done during your inspection.

Keep Your HVAC Clean and Clear of Debris

Air conditioning summer issues are sometimes caused by debris being built up during the spring and winter months. When this hasn’t been cleared away it may cause blockages to your outdoor unit. Things such as dirt, twigs, and leaves can build up and cause your AC unit to overheat.

 

Along with your outdoor unit having the ability to become dirty, so does the inside of your AC unit.

Replace Air Filters

If you’ve noticed that you are sneezing or coughing more inside your home during the spring and summer months, you may have a buildup of dirt on your air filter. When air filters become dirty, they will work hard to remove allergens from your air.

Making sure to routinely replace these will help keep your air conditioner summer month prepped.

Clean Condenser Coils

A dirty condenser coil will cause your air conditioning system to have trouble cooling down the air around you. To ensure that your AC is ready for those hot summer nights, try to keep these as clean as you can.
